One of the most exciting features coming in last year’s iOS 16 release was a whole new level of customization for your lock screen. Instead of allowing you to just set a static image, Apple has opened the floodgates to allow you to create screens that cycle through a collection of photos of your friends, pets and landscapes, live weather updates and See astronomical conditions, and much more.

This feature remains mostly the same in iOS 17, although Apple made a nice change in iOS 17.1 so that you can now add any of your albums to show on the Photo Shuffle lock screen instead of being limited to certain smart collections of people, pets, etc. Can select. Nature, and the city. You can still set multiple lock screens to cycle through, and this now also means multiple photo shuffle screens to choose images from different albums. Since these can be set to automatically come into different focus modes, you can have your iPhone automatically switch between an album of professional photos at work and family photos at home.

While the new standby mode in iOS 17 means you’ll be able to look at your lock screen less often while your iPhone is charging, it only turns on when you turn your phone sideways. So, you can still leave it flat on the charger and still enjoy your lock screen, which looks especially nice on Apple’s iPhone 15 Pro and iPhone 15 Pro Max with the rich, full-color always-on display. Kind of works.

Although your home screen still lets you set a static photo to appear behind your app icons, you can now choose to blur that background or dress it up a bit with some filters. What’s even more fun is that your home screen wallpaper is paired with each lock screen you set, so it changes with each one. By default, you get a blurred version of the associated lock screen image, but you can still set it to another image in your photo library as before.

How to set a custom home screen wallpaper when configuring your lock screen

When you create a new lock screen wallpaper or edit an existing one, your iPhone will present a blurred version of the same wallpaper for the background on your home screen. This leads you to choose it more prominently set as wallpaper couple button, but you don’t have to accept it by default.

step 1: From your iPhone’s lock screen, press and hold any empty space to open the lock screen picker.

step 2: Create a new lock screen by selecting plus signature In the lower right corner.

step 3: Customize your new lock screen just the way you like it. Check out our article on how to customize your iPhone lock screen on iOS 16 for more details on what you can do here.

step 4: When you’re done, select Add (Or Done If you are editing an existing lock screen). A preview of your lock screen and home screen wallpaper appears.

Step 5: choose Customize Home Screen To choose a different wallpaper for your home screen. A new home screen wallpaper editing view opens.

Step 6: Skip from the options below couple Selected (Original on iOS 16.0) to have the same wallpaper as your lock screen; choose Colour Or shield To choose a static background, select or photos To select another image from your photo library.

Step 7: The color and gradient options are preset to use a background that matches your lock screen wallpaper. To choose a different color or gradient, select Colour Or shield Press the button a second time to bring up the color picker.

Step 8: choose stigma To choose whether you want to blur your home screen wallpaper. This option is only available when using a matching lock screen wallpaper or custom photo; This will not activate when using colors or gradients as there is nothing to blur in that case.

Step 9: When you’ve customized your home screen wallpaper to your liking, select Done In the top-right corner.

How to change your current home screen wallpaper from the lock screen

Apple has made it easier in iOS 16.1 to customize your home screen wallpaper directly from the lock screen without you having to go into lock screen settings first.

step 1: From your iPhone’s lock screen, press and hold any empty space to open the lock screen picker.

step 2: Swipe left or right to locate the lock screen for which you want to edit the corresponding home screen wallpaper.

step 3: Choose customize button below the lock screen image.

step 4: Tap Home screen wallpaper on the right. The home screen wallpaper editing view opens.

Step 5: Please select from the options below couple ,Original on iOS 16.0) To use the same wallpaper as your lock screen, Colour Or shield To choose a static background, or photos To select a different image from your photo library.

Step 6: If you are using pair/original or photo, you can select stigma To toggle the blurring of the image on your home screen.

Step 7: When finished, select Done To return to the lock screen picker.

Step 8: Select the lock screen of your choice to exit the lock screen picker.

How to change your home screen wallpaper from the Settings app

You can instantly choose a new home screen wallpaper for your current lock screen, just like setting a wallpaper in prior versions of iOS. This skips the step of opening the lock screen wallpaper editor and takes you straight to choosing a home screen wallpaper instead.

As long as you’re running iOS 16.1 or later (and you really should be by now), you can swipe between your different wallpaper pairs or add a new one by tapping + Add new wallpaper button.

step 1: Open the Settings app on your iPhone.

step 2: choose Wallpaper, A preview of your current lock screen and home screen wallpaper is shown.

step 3: Choose customize button at the bottom right of the home screen wallpaper preview. The home screen wallpaper editing view opens.

step 4: Please select from the options below couple ,Original on iOS 16.0) To use the same wallpaper as your lock screen, Colour Or shield To choose a static background, or photos To select an image from your photo library.

Step 5: choose stigma To toggle the blur of the photo wallpaper.

Step 6: When you are satisfied with your home screen wallpaper, select Done in the top-right corner to save your selections and return to wallpaper settings.

If you customized your wallpaper to use a color, gradient, or different photo and later decide you want to go back to using a wallpaper paired with your lock screen, repeat the above steps and select couple option (or Original on iOS 16.0).
